TATA Innovation Fellowship

Applications are invited for “Tata Innovation Fellowship”, a highly competitive scheme instituted by the Department of Biotechnology, Ministry of Science & Technology, Govt. of India to recognize and reward scientists with oustanding track record in biological sciences and a deep commitment to find innovative solutions to major problems in health care, agriculture and other areas related to life sciences and biotechnology.

OBJECTIVE

The scheme is aimed at rewarding interdisciplinary work where major emphasis is on innovation and translational research with a potential towards commercialization.

ELIGIBILITY

i)      The fellowship is open to Indian Nationals residing in India who are below the age of 55 years as on 21st November, 2011.

ii)       The applicant should possess a Ph.D. degree in Life Sciences, Agriculture, Veterinary Science or a Master’s degree in Medical Sciences, Engineering or an equivalent degree in Biotechnology/related areas. The applicant must have put in several years of work in the specific area.

iii)      The candidate must have a regular position in a University/Institute/Organization and should be engaged in research and development. If he/she is availing any other fellowship, he/she will have to opt for only one of the fellowships.

iv)      The applicant should have spent atleast 5 years in India before applying for the fellowship.

NATURE OF SUPPORT

0 The amount of the fellowship is R& 20,000/- per month in addition to regular salary from the host institute (Revision of fellowship to Rs. 25,000/- p.m. is under consideration). If an awardee is receiving salary from international organization, he will be entitled for research grant i.e. contingency only.

i) In addition, each Fellow will receive a contingency grant of Rs. 5.00 lakh per annum for meeting the expenses on consumables, equipment, international and domestic travel, manpower and other contingent expenditure to be incurred in connection with the implementation of ongoing research project under the fellowship.

iii)      The Tata Innovation Fellows would be eligible for other regular research grant(s) through extramural and other research schemes of various S&T agencies of the Government of India.

HOST INSTITUTION

i)        The candidate will continue to work at the place of his/her employment.

ii)       The Institution where the candidate is working would provide the necessary infrastructure and administrative support for pursuing the research under this fellowship.

NUMBER

Number of fellowships is 5 per year. DURATION

The duration of the fellowship will be initially for three years, extendable further by two years on a fresh appraisal.

India’s Changing Business Landscape

Entrepreneurship, Innovation and Succession: India’s Changing Business Landscape

Published: September 16, 2011 in India Knowledge@Wharton

Over the past 20 years, India’s information technology and outsourcing companies have grown at an extraordinary pace, with many reaching revenue numbers in the billions of U.S. dollars and seeing staff sizes grow exponentially. But this is almost entirely in the services arena; in product space, Indian companies have been singularly unsuccessful. Services may well have been the path of least resistance, said panelists during a discussion at the 15th Wharton India Economic Forum in Philadelphia.

“Whether you use Accenture, IBM or Wipro, India is literally the back office for global information technology,” according to Vish Tadimety, chairman and CEO of CyberTech Systems and Software, a leading provider of geo-solutions in India and the U.S. But thus far, Indian companies have not proved as successful in the product and shrink-wrapped software realm. With so many Indian multinationals increasing operations outside the country, many in the Indian business community are asking if India is preparing to remain competitive in the changing economic ecosystem. Does India have the resources, structures and innovation it needs to meet the challenges of the coming decade? What are the opportunities for first-time entrepreneurs in India?

TATA TiE Stree Shakti Awards

The TiE Stree Shakti (TSS) Workshop and Awards is a forum for women entrepreneurs to create trust-based partnerships through active networking. The objective of TSS is to create a platform of belonging for women entrepreneurs.

TSS is spearheaded by a power panel of accomplished and successful women – Anita Ramchandran, Cerebrus; Bharti Jacob, Seed Fund; Chanda Kocchar, ICICI Bank; Farzana Haque, TCS; Gita Dang, Talent Advisory Services; Ireena Vittal, McKinsey; Rama Bijapurkar, Market Strategist and Author and Shikha Sharma, Axis Bank. Also on the panel are TIE members and successful entrepreneurs in their own right, including Shilpi Kapoor, Purvi Sheth and Sridar Iyengar, President, TiE Mumbai

As part of its efforts to enable women entrepreneurs, the initiative includes:

• On-ground focused activities for Women Entrepreneurs across various TiE Chapters, leveraging the existing TiE charter of activities.

• An annual conference for women entrepreneurs that aims to recognize, reward, educate, mentor and enable.

Pricewaterhouse Coopers (PWCC) has signed up as Process Partners for the awards definition and selection process.

TATA Group, one of India’s largest and most respected business conglomerates has signed on as partner for the initiative.
